Fonseka’s field marshal ranking runs into trouble

The promotion of Gen. Sarath Fonseka, leader of the Democratic Party, to the rank of field marshal on March 22 has run into trouble following a request by him to absorb him into active service of the Army, say defence ministry sources.

Several leading figures in the government have objected to Fonseka being thus given the opportunity to give orders to the Army.

It is appropriate to give him the ranking in recognition of his commitment to defeat the LTTE, but it should be a nominal one only, they have proposed to the president.

The president is yet to take a decision on this matter, but has advised Fonseka to prepare his uniform and stars and stripes to suit the field marshal position.

Fonseka’s recommendations set aside

Meanwhile, Fonseka’s appointment of several officers loyal to him to top positions in the Army has been reversed.

On the orders of the president and the prime minister, the new Army
commander has annulled those postings.
